How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Southeast Houston?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Southeast Houston Studio Apartments | $1,480 | $305 | $5,177 |
| Southeast Houston 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,452 | $350 | $10,000+ |
| Southeast Houston 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,816 | $580 | $10,000+ |
| Southeast Houston 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,223 | $704 | $10,000+ |
| Southeast Houston 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,109 | $600 | $10,000+ |
| Southeast Houston 5 Bedroom Apartments | $5,037 | $835 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Southeast Houston
How much are Studio apartments in Southeast Houston?
There are currently 397 Studio Apartments in Southeast Houston with rent ranges from $305 to $5,177 with an average price of $1,480.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Southeast Houston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Southeast Houston ranges from $350 to $13,699 with an average monthly rent of $1,452.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Southeast Houston c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Southeast Houston range from $580 to $25,057.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,816.
How expensive are Southeast Houston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 572 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Southeast Houston on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$704 to $16,311 - averaging $2,223 for the location.
